F-box and WD repeat domain-containing protein 7 (FBW7), also known as FBXW7, AGO or hCDC4, is an F-box protein with seven tandem WD40 repeats. FBW7 is a key substrate recognition subunit of the Skp1-Cul1-F-box-protein E3 ubiquitin ligase. FBW7 targets for ubiquitination and destruction of numerous crucial transcription factors and protooncogenes, including cyclin E, c-Myc, c-Jun, Notch and MCL-1. FBW7 is a well-characterized tumor suppressor, and its gene is frequently mutated or deleted in various types of human cancer, including colorectal cancer, gastric cancer, ovarian cancer and different types of leukemia. Accumulating evidence indicates that the aberrant expression of FBW7 is involved in the development of hematological tumors, including T cell acute lymphoblastic leukemia, adult T cell leukemia/lymphoma, chronic lymphocytic leukemia and multiple myeloma. The present review will describe the latest findings on the role of FBW7 in hematological tumors, in order to identify a novel target for future therapies.

Ultraviolet A (UVA) is a major factor in skin aging and damage. Antioxidative materials may ameliorate this UV damage. This study investigated the protective properties of N-(4-bromophenethyl) caffeamide (K36H) against UVA-induced skin inflammation, apoptosis and genotoxicity in keratinocytes. The protein expression or biofactor concentration related to UVA-induced skin damage were identified using an en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ay and western blotting. K36H reduced UVA-induced intracellular reactive oxygen species generation and increased nuclear factor erythroid 2-related factor 2 translocation into the nucleus to upregulate the expression of heme oxygenase-1, an intrinsic antioxidant enzyme. K36H inhibited UVA-induced activation of extracellular-signal-regulated kinases and c-Jun N-terminal kinases, reduced the overexpression of matrix metalloproteinase (MMP)-1 and MMP-2 and elevated the expression of the metalloproteinase-1 tissue inhibitor. Moreover, K36H inhibited the phosphorylation of c-Jun and downregulated c-Fos expression. K36H attenuated UVA-induced Bax and caspase-3 expression and upregulated antiapoptotic protein B-cell lymphoma 2 expression. K36H reduced UVA-induced DNA damage. K36H also downregulated inducible nitric oxide synthase, cyclooxygenase-2 and interleukin-6 expression as well as the subsequent generation of prostaglandin E2 and nitric oxide. We observed that K36H ameliorated UVA-induced oxidative stress, inflammation, apoptosis and antiphotocarcinogenic activity. K36H can potentially be used for the development of antiphotodamage and antiphotocarcinogenic products.
